Output cfaf64b7c52fc95f3d9235e0ab1818bc7d121b53e84d9081c084f7f4db265873:1

value
1699423
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d537269d4fd1945c76c0ec86fbf39df5e1af684 OP_EQUALVERIFY OP_CHECKSIG
address
16bGBhMipHQ9feudwc8FMvZVJaAuZkcQWU
transaction
cfaf64b7c52fc95f3d9235e0ab1818bc7d121b53e84d9081c084f7f4db265873
spent
true